A board game producer represents a comprehensive manufacturing and development entity that specializes in creating, designing, and distributing tabletop gaming experiences for diverse audiences worldwide. This sophisticated operation encompasses multiple stages of production, from initial concept development through final retail distribution, utilizing advanced manufacturing technologies and creative design processes. The board game producer integrates traditional craftsmanship with modern production techniques to deliver high-quality gaming products that meet contemporary market demands. These companies employ specialized equipment including precision cutting machines, digital printing systems, advanced molding technologies, and automated assembly lines to ensure consistent product quality and efficient production workflows. The technological infrastructure of a modern board game producer includes computer-aided design software, prototype development tools, quality control systems, and inventory management platforms that streamline operations from conception to consumer delivery. Applications of board game producer services extend across educational institutions, entertainment companies, independent designers, and established gaming publishers who require professional manufacturing capabilities. The production process involves material sourcing, component fabrication, artwork integration, packaging design, and distribution coordination, all managed through sophisticated project management systems. Board game producers serve various market segments including family entertainment, educational gaming, strategic gaming communities, and collector markets, each requiring specialized production approaches and quality standards. These facilities typically maintain extensive supplier networks for materials such as cardboard, plastics, wood, metal components, and specialized gaming accessories. The modern board game producer utilizes environmentally conscious manufacturing practices, implementing sustainable materials and waste reduction strategies while maintaining production efficiency and product durability standards that ensure long-term customer satisfaction and market competitiveness.

Advanced Manufacturing Technology Integration

Advanced Manufacturing Technology Integration

The modern board game producer leverages cutting-edge manufacturing technology that revolutionizes traditional gaming product development through precision engineering and automated production systems. This technological integration encompasses sophisticated printing equipment capable of producing vibrant, high-resolution graphics on various materials including cardstock, plastic, and specialty substrates that enhance visual appeal and durability. Digital printing systems enable cost-effective short-run production and rapid prototyping, allowing designers to test market responses before committing to large-scale manufacturing investments. Computer-controlled cutting and shaping equipment ensures precise component dimensions and consistent quality across thousands of units, eliminating variations that could affect gameplay mechanics or product assembly. Injection molding capabilities allow board game producers to create custom plastic components with intricate details and specialized shapes that would be impossible through traditional manufacturing methods. These advanced systems support multi-color molding, transparent materials, and complex geometries that enhance gaming experiences and product differentiation. Automated assembly lines integrate quality control sensors, packaging systems, and inventory tracking technologies that streamline production workflows while maintaining rigorous quality standards. This technological infrastructure enables board game producers to handle complex projects involving multiple components, materials, and specifications without compromising efficiency or accuracy. The integration of 3D printing capabilities for prototype development accelerates design iteration cycles and enables rapid testing of component functionality before full-scale production begins. Digital workflow management systems coordinate all aspects of production from initial design files through final packaging, ensuring seamless communication between design teams, production staff, and quality control personnel. These technological advantages translate into faster turnaround times, reduced production costs, and superior product quality that meets demanding consumer expectations in competitive gaming markets while supporting innovative design concepts that push creative boundaries.

Sustainable Manufacturing and Environmental Responsibility

Sustainable Manufacturing and Environmental Responsibility

Leading board game producers demonstrate commitment to environmental sustainability through innovative manufacturing practices, responsible material sourcing, and comprehensive waste reduction programs that address growing consumer and industry concerns about environmental impact. This commitment encompasses implementation of eco-friendly materials including recycled cardboard, sustainably sourced wood components, and biodegradable plastics that maintain product quality while reducing environmental footprint. Water-based inks and adhesives replace traditional chemical alternatives, eliminating harmful emissions and reducing environmental contamination while maintaining printing quality and component durability standards. Energy-efficient manufacturing equipment and renewable energy sources power production facilities, significantly reducing carbon emissions and operational environmental impact while maintaining competitive production costs and delivery schedules. Waste reduction programs include comprehensive recycling systems, material optimization strategies, and packaging minimization initiatives that divert production waste from landfills while reducing raw material consumption and associated costs. Board game producers implement circular economy principles through component design strategies that facilitate end-of-life recycling, material recovery, and sustainable disposal options that extend product lifecycle responsibility beyond initial manufacturing phases. Supply chain sustainability initiatives include vendor certification programs, transportation optimization, and local sourcing strategies that reduce shipping emissions while supporting regional economic development and maintaining quality standards. These environmental responsibility programs often exceed regulatory requirements and industry standards, positioning board game producers as leaders in sustainable manufacturing practices that appeal to environmentally conscious consumers and business partners. Certification programs including Forest Stewardship Council approval, ISO environmental standards, and carbon footprint verification provide third-party validation of sustainability commitments and enable transparent communication of environmental achievements to stakeholders. Investment in sustainable technology development includes research partnerships, equipment upgrades, and process innovations that continuously improve environmental performance while maintaining production efficiency and product quality. These sustainability initiatives create competitive advantages through cost reduction, risk mitigation, regulatory compliance, and brand differentiation that attract environmentally conscious clients and support long-term business growth in increasingly sustainability-focused markets.
